> Our luck with this test has been quite good, but it sometimes fails
> to show its last lines of output.  That is, we send a USR1 to the
> trigger processes to set off the final output and we immediately
> cat the output files.  If there is any delay in handling the signal,
> the last output will be missing.
>
> Have the processes terminate themselves when their last output is
> flushed; then wait for those processes.  Also, skip testing altogether if
> there is only a single processor to run the two, hard-spinning processes.
